SYSTEM DOCUMENTATION & REQUIREMENTS

What problem does it solve?

Weekly engineering retrospective generation and team-aware analysis of commit history, PRs, tests, and code quality signals, with growth opportunities and persistent history.

Core Features & Use Cases

  • Per-person contribution breakdown with praise and growth opportunities.
  • Time-window based retrospectives (7d default, 24h, 14d, 30d, compare options) to track trends.
  • Team narrative generation suitable for documentation and messaging (Telegram-ready).
  • Memory of prior retros to compute deltas and trend insights.
